Basic Life Support for Health Care Providers
 
Candidate Requirement
Anybody who is working in the profession of healthcare

Course Objectives: To teach the skills of CPR for victims of all ages (including ventilation with barrier devices, a bag mask device and oxygen), use of an Automated External Defibrillator and relief of foreign body airway obstruction. It is intended for participants who provide health care to patients in a wide variety of settings.

Course Content:
  • Adult and Infant Chain of Survival
  • Learn how to call 999 or 112
  • Learn CPR for Adults, Children and infants 1 and 2 rescuers
  • AED Instruction
  • Recognition and relief of Choking in adults and children in responsive and unresponsive victims
  • Scenario based practice
  • Practical evaluation
  • Written exam

Certification: An Irish Heart Association BLS for Healthcare Providers Course Completion card.
Duration: approx 4 hours
No. of Attendees: 6 participants to 1 Instructor
